I am following the Brazilian trend of using sweet potatoes not only in desserts but also in savory dishes such as mashed sweet potatoes and stir-fried sliced sweet potatoes. My famous mashed sweet potatoes was inspired by the Brazilian dish quibebe or mashed pumpkin with coconut milk and cilantro.
Although most Brazilians use milk in their mashed sweet potatoes, I use coconut milk in mine. I am from the Northeast region where coconut milk is abundant and ever-present at our tables. If you are not a fan of coconut milk, no worries-- although you might be surprised by how mild its taste is, you can replaced it with milk, if desired. 🙁 You can also substitute parsley instead of cilantro if you prefer.

Mashed Sweet Potatoes with Coconut Milk, Bacon, and Cilantro
Ingredients
- 3 pounds sweet potatoes peeled and cut into 1-inch pieces
- ¾ cup coconut milk heated
- 1-½ tablespoon garlic powder
- 1 tablespoon Knorr chicken flavor bouillon ** powder
- 1 pinch freshly ground nutmeg
- ¾ cup fully cooked smoked bacon cut into small pieces and sauteed
- Salt and black ground pepper to taste
- ½ cup fresh cilantro chopped
- ** Knorr chicken flavor bouillon powder is available at Latin markets and also at local supermarkets (Latin aisle).
Instructions
- Boil sweet potatoes in a large pot of cold salted water until very tender (about 15 minutes). Drain. Let stand in colander 2-5 minutes. Purée sweet potatoes with a potato ricer or masher; then, stir in the coconut milk until mixture is homogeneous and creamy.
- Add the garlic and chicken bouillon powder, nutmeg, sauteed bacon, salt and pepper; stir well.
- Before serving, stir in the chopped cilantro.
